Does Sierra Leone have a low energy access rate?

Sierra Leone currently has one of the lowest energy access rates globally, with only 36% of its population connected to the grid and a mere 6% in rural areas. Will Sierra Leone be fully illuminated by 2027?

The SOGREA Initiative supports the government's aim to increase the share of renewable energy in the country's energy mix to 35% by 2030. “By 2027, Sierra Leone will be fully illuminated. This isn't just about light; it's about igniting green industrialisation and fulfilling the National Development Plan as a Government.

What is the sogre initiative & how does it help Sierra Leone?

The SOGREA initiative directly supports Sierra Leone's Energy Transition and Green Growth Plan (ETGGP), launched in November 2024 under the Presidential Initiative on Climate Change, Renewable Energy, and Food Security (PICREF).

Are green mini-grids the best way to electrify Sierra Leone?

The Government of Sierra Leone (GoSL) has identified green mini-grids as the most suitable means to electrify a significant number of communities, given their cost-effectiveness. SOGREA is designed to build on past successes and lessons learned to scale up the mini-grid sector and strengthen its sustainability.
